First time I've lost a game this way...
This was a new way for me to lose a game - leading 2-1 in the top of the 9th with two outs and runners at 1st and 3rd, the tying run scored on a passed ball on an uncaught third strike.
After a walk to load the bases, another passed ball on a strikeout allowed the go-ahead run to score, putting my team down 3-2! After a pitching change, a strikeout finally got me out of the inning (the fourth strikeout of the inning, added to a sacrifice bunt which had been the first out). There was no comeback in the bottom of the 9th and the final score was 3-2 - definitely the strangest circumstances I have lost a game in so far. |
